The British Invasion Project

In just under a month I will be invading Britain! And, in return for that I have decided that I will allow a British invasion of my own. For the four months that I spend on London Study Abroad I will be listening to only British music. Part of this will be difficult because neither country music nor Bon Jovi hail from Britain. However, my musical selections are not nearly as limited as you might think.

Here is a list of some of the music I will be allowing myself to listen to:
